## Releases

Hey support folks — quick notes on ProfileMesh shard releases. Each release re-balances user-profile shards gradually, so don't panic if a lookup lands on a stale shard for a few minutes post-deploy; it self-heals. Release bundles are published twice a month and are always signed. If a customer asks you to verify a bundle they downloaded, walk them through the checksum step using the public signing key below.

deploy key for kawif-bageg: bky19_YQNdHDgpaLxUNwPoHm9

CI note — Murkwell audio pipeline. The waveform preview job fails intermittently on the render step, always on runners with the older decoder image. Symptom: the preview PNG is truncated, and the diff check flags it as a regression rather than an infra fault. Careful here: retrying masks the issue, so do not simply re-run. Instead, pin the job to the updated decoder image and confirm the preview renders at full width. If it still fails, escalate with logs attached and quote the trace token below.

pipeline stamp: htk9_ce63042d9

Taking over from Maro, here's where things stand. The Kestrelwave JavaScript SDK now matches the Python client on retry semantics, pagination cursors, and webhook signing. Still missing on the JS side: batched uploads and the offline queue. Plugin authors targeting both SDKs should stick to the shared surface documented in the parity matrix until those land, likely next quarter. Both clients read the same service settings, so plugins can assume identical defaults. For reference, the current configuration values are as follows.

deployment values, yahag-tawef:
ZORWYN_HOST=zorwyn.tolvaqlabs.internal
ZORWYN_PORT=9300

## Deployment

Heads up for review: this release ships the Quellgraph batching layer that fixes the N+1 blowup on nested resolver calls. Instead of one DB hit per child node, resolvers now queue lookups into a per-request DataLoader with a hard cap, so a malicious deeply-nested query can't fan out unbounded. The cap and batch window are configurable per environment. The deploy uses the following configuration values.

deployment values, fahap-hahaf:
[casdor]
port = 9200
region = south-2
host = casdor.qirvanworks.corp
timeout_ms = 3000
retries = 4